WebApr 12, 2024 · ICS is pushing up variable rates by 1.25% across all loan-to-value (LTV) bands. Buy-to-let mortgage rates will increase between 0.15% and 1.25%, depending on the product and LTV. New home mover and switcher mortgages will rise between 0.60% and 1.00%, but existing fixed-rate customers won’t be impacted.
